    There is something about deep mysteries of the Scriptures, it is very slippery. It looks like a conspiracy theory. In a conspiracy theory, you may think that you have fixed the puzzles and have gotten all things right without knowing that you have missed it and deviated in many parts.

    So far, in series I & II, we have been able, by His Grace to clarify the meanings of some Scriptures used by “Pre-Adamic advocates”. And in this edition, I will talk about Ezekiel 28:13a

    “You were in Eden, the garden of God”.

    With that passage, they have said Lucifer was the first resident of Eden. But this can’t be true except they are saying that there were two Edens- one before Adam and another after Adam. See the Scriptures: Gen. 2:8

    Then the Lord God planted a garden in Eden in the east, and there he placed the man he had made.

    With all indications, this doesn’t looks like what God was doing for the second time. It was the first time. The Bible says…and there he placed man-Adam. Read verse 9 of that passage to see how God planted and set the trees in His garden.

    So, referring to “Lucifer” as an occupant of Eden in Ezekiel is only a poetic term. It was only used figuratively to give a close picture of what happened. It is like telling you that “the fellowship of yesterday was haven” or, “there home is Eden”. There are other places in the Bible where Eden was used figuratively. In the same Book of Ezekiel, Chapter 31:8, the nation of Assyria was referred to as a tree in Eden.

    Meanwhile, the passage we are discussing was not only referring to Lucifer. Infact, contextually, it has nothing to do with Lucifer but by understanding, we know it also addresses him.

    Now, let me teach you something. Poetic and Prophetic books of the Bible like Ezekiel are the most dicey to interpret but if you know the key, it will be easy. The first key is that, they talk in tenses. They can talk about the present, past or future tense within a single verse or chapter. The second key is that “they usually have two to three referents- that is, whom they are referring to”. So, before you interpret any line, ask yourself: “to whom was this said”, it could be one or two or even three. The writer could be referring to himself, or an immediate character or a distant character. That is why, when you read Psalms, a verse may be referring to David and then the next line within the same verse, is prophetically referring to Jesus Christ. At some other times, the same verse could address both David and Jesus Christ.

    Let’s go back to the book of Ezekiel. That verse was essentially referring to both “the King of Tyre” and “Lucifer”, comparing them to “Adam” who was sent away from Eden after he sinned. The King of Tyre sinned, and God also sent him away from His glory. Lucifer also sinned and was sent away.

    In this edition, I will talk about “replenish” as used by God in Genesis 1:28: “And God blessed them, and God said unto them, Be fruitful, and multiply, and REPLENISH the earth.”

    Scholars who believed that some beings or kind of humans once inhabited the earth always refer to God asking man to replenish the earth as a strong point. Their standpoint is that, “replenish” means to refill or renew and so how would God ask men to replenish the earth if not that it was once corrupted by some kind of creation.

    I must confess that it took me years to unlock this part. While I was meditating on it one night, the Holy Spirit told me to check the dictionary. I knew I had done that before but I obliged to check again. I was surprised to realize that the archaic meaning of the word “replenish” is “to fill”. That means, when KJV was written, the word “replenish” means “to fill” the earth and not to refill or renew the earth. Then, I checked modern translations and I realized they used the word “fill the earth.” See Amplified:

    “And God blessed them [granting them certain authority] and said to them, “Be fruitful, multiply, and FILL THE EARTH. Gen1:28.”

    I decided to check the original Hebrew word that was used and I found “mâlê’ mâlâ.” Guess the meaning? It simply means “to fill”.

    In this light, we know that God asking men to mâlê’ mâlâ the earth means to occupy and fill the new earth He just created and it by no means talk about re-filling.

    This is one topic being discussed as a “mystery” in Christendom. Many respected ministers of God have asserted that there was indeed a “pre-Adamic World”. By this, they mean that there was a set of people or beings who occupied the planet Earth before Adam came to be. A preacher said Lucifer was sent like Jesus to those people but he rebelled against God and won those people to his side. Another respected minister of the gospel said, it was those people that became demons. He said demons were not the fallen angels but the set of people who occupied the first world. Another minister alludes that there were also animals in that world.

    Believe me, the ministers which I quoted above with names withheld are men and masters whom I hold in high esteem till date only that I disagree with some of their opinions on this subject matter.

    Let’s start like this:

    1. “Was there a pre-adamic world?”
      It depends on what this grammar means to you. Before Adam was created, there was something. And from my study, that is nothing but the “spirit world”. That was when the angels were made or created. Each of the angels were moulded by God. They don’t have an ancestry like human beings. So, as many as they are, God formed each of them.

    The rebellion of Satan against God was also before the Adamic age. If you read the account in the book of Revelation, you may think it happened much later or in-between. I guess that was why some people have suggested that there were two categories of men or beings that occupied the earth.

    The first argument of those who believed in a pre-Adamic being is that there was a GAP in-between Genesis 1:1 and Genesis 1:2. Those who talk about this tends to sound sincerely deep but there’s actually nothing deep about it. Any literature student will understand that it was just a writing style.

    Genesis 1:1 says,
    In the beginning God CREATED the heaven and the earth.

    And verse 2 says,
    And the earth was without form, and void.

    With that sequence, people assumed that, after God had created heaven and earth, something happened that made the earth became VOID and FORMLESS. But that’s a misunderstanding.

    In literature, this is a style of writing which “concludes a story before saying the details”. Have you tried to watch a movie before and out of curiosity, you told a friend to tell you the end before you commence watching it? Like, you asked your friend, “did the actor die at the end”? That was exactly what happened here. The writer of Genesis told us God created the heaven and the earth and then explained to us how the heaven (firmament) was made as well as the earth.

    This same style of writing was adopted through the Old Testament especially in the account of 2Kings and the Chronicles. A chapter would open by saying, a king reigned and did evil and the next verse will tell us about his reign details. This same style was used in Genesis 1:27. The passage states that God made all men in his image but told us the details of that creation in Chapter 2. Some have misunderstood this passage as well and assumed that God made some set of men in Chapter 1 before making Adam in Chapter 2.

    With this understanding, we can therefore read Genesis 1:1-2 this way; “In the beginning God created the heaven and the earth. The space which we now call earth used to be without form, and void, (full of waters)….”

     

    Remember that another word for “earth” is sand, land or soil. If I want to sound deep, I will take you to the Hebrew rendition-“‘erets”. “Erets” simply means land. So, this space wasn’t called Earth until God asked land to appear. Read:

    Genesis 1:8-9
    9 And God said, Let the waters under the heaven be gathered together unto one place, and let the dry LAND APPEAR: and it was so.
    10 And God called the DRY LAND EARTH….
